Non - zero digits are always significant. Start counting significant figures from the first non - zero digit on the left. Trailing zeros to the left of the decimal point location may be ambiguous. Captive zeros (between non - zero digits) are significant. Leading zeros are not significant. Exponential notation can resolve ambiguity in significant figures for numbers with trailing zeros to the left of the decimal point. When only decimal - formatted number is available, assume trailing zeros are significant.
